June 2025 monthly summary for SAP/SapMachine: Focused on stabilizing UI tests by correcting a GlyphView test string mismatch (bug4188841). Updated the test expectation to 'the quick brown fox jumps over the lazy dog!' to reflect the intended functionality, reducing flaky failures and increasing confidence in UI behavior. The change involved a single test file update and related commit; overall impact includes more reliable build, clearer test intent, and improved regression coverage.
